This is a short horror visual novel inspired by true events I've experienced,

In Purple Maniac you play as a father with his baby in a bathroom stall. Then a murderer and his latest victim enter the restroom. You have to keep your baby quiet while you hear the slaughter coming from right beside you. Do you cover your baby's ears to the sound of a power drill or rock them to sleep?

A five-minute visual novel proving that sometimes the smartest move is to step away when things don’t work. A very short game where you play as Henry and his baby son, Jason, who decide to go see a movie. Afterward, Jason needs a diaper change, and the only option is a nearby public restroom. While there, Henry investigates strange noises coming from inside, and ends up getting shot. This is just one of the quick endings you’ll encounter if you make the wrong choices. The gameplay is simple: you must choose between rocking the baby or covering his ears while a murderer tortures a victim outside. The killer describes what he’s about to do, giving you clues, but often just covering Jason’s ears is enough to progress. A wrong choice means death, while the correct one moves you forward to the next stage of torture with the same two options. You repeat this process until the murderer eventually leaves. You can slightly change the end by informing the cops, and there’s one decision that leads to the best ending. Since you can save before making a decision, you don’t have to replay the entire game after each mistake.
